Hi all,

I have 1 C-More and 6 BX-DM1E-18ED23's on Ethernet. Today I just turned power on and
the C-more messages: PLC communication timeout.
Two of the 6 PLC's IP address go back to default!
I know that the IP address is stored in the ROM, so what should we do to prevent this?
Using SETUPIP with $FirstScan?

The IP settings are stored in the same flash memory as the GA, OS, user program, system config, etc, so it is highly unlikely that they just 'lost' the settings without affecting anything else.

You mentioned powering up the PLCs. Did you recently clear them PLC memory and reload them? If the System Settings were cleared when you did that, the Ethernet ports will continue to work until the PLC is power cycled.
